Changed defaults in Splitfork, our assignment service. Bucketing now uses sticky hashing per account instead of per session, and the holdout slice grew from 2% to 5%. Callers relying on session-level reassignment must opt in explicitly. Review the diff against the new baseline; the updated default configuration is listed below.

config for tagep-kajof:
[casir]
port = 6379
region = south-1
host = casir.paliqdyn.example
team = tamax
timeout_ms = 250
retries = 2

To the incoming director: please review the Brackenholt discount framework carefully before approving any deal above the enterprise threshold. Discounts up to 15% are delegated to regional managers; 15–25% requires your sign-off with a margin justification; anything beyond 25% goes to the pricing committee. Historic exceptions have eroded margins on multi-year agreements, so we now require renewal pricing to be modelled at standard rates. Context on why this matters strategically is recorded confidentially below.

internal memo for kawip-hadug: Headcount on the Wenwyn team goes from 7 to 140 by the end of January. Gross margin on Wenwyn came in at 20 percent against a plan of 15 percent.

MEMO — Eastern Corridor Expansion

Team — good news on the expansion front. We're moving ahead with the Thalmere region launch, starting with two reps out of the Bryce Hollow office. Demand signals from the Larkspur pilot were stronger than expected, so leadership wants us selling there by spring. Don't mention this to partners yet. The reasoning, which stays in this group, is below.

board note of kageg-bahof: The renewal with Holwynax Holdings closes at $2 million a year, 5 percent below the last contract. Project Ulaath slips by two quarters because of the supplier delay.

## Authentication

The Splitgate assignment service issues deterministic experiment buckets for all Marrowtech client apps. Every assignment request must carry a service credential; unauthenticated calls are rejected to prevent bucket enumeration. Credentials are scoped per environment and cannot cross staging/production boundaries. Assignment logs record the calling key's fingerprint, never the key itself, and are retained for 90 days. Reviewers validating the staging integration should use the staging credential, which appears below.

gateway credential: kto3_qfe